About Corniche Casablanca
The Corniche Casablanca is a scenic promenade that stretches along the Atlantic coast, offering a blend of natural beauty and urban excitement. It features wide walkways perfect for leisurely strolls or cycling, lined with palm trees, cafes, and modern hotels. The area is renowned for its lively nightlife, with numerous seafood restaurants and bars that cater to all tastes. This promenade serves as an ideal place to relax, socialize, and enjoy panoramic views of the ocean. Visitors can also explore nearby attractions like the Hassan II Mosque or enjoy beach activities in designated zones. History
The Corniche Casablanca has evolved over decades into the city’s premier seaside boulevard. Originally developed in the mid-20th century, it became a focal point for social, cultural, and leisure activities. The area grew in popularity alongside Casablanca's economic expansion, attracting both locals and international visitors. As the city modernized, the Corniche was renovated and expanded to include new recreational facilities, luxury hotels, and entertainment venues. Throughout its history, the Corniche has reflected Casablanca's vibrant and cosmopolitan spirit. It has become a symbol of the city’s dynamic lifestyle and its position as a major North African port. Today, it continues to be a hub of activity, blending traditional Moroccan culture with modern urban flair.

Best Time to Visit
Visit during spring (March to May) or autumn (September to November) for the ideal weather conditions conducive to outdoor activities and sightseeing.

Things to Know
Wear comfortable clothing and footwear to enjoy walking along the promenade. Sun protection is recommended during the day, especially in summer. Be cautious of crowds during peak hours and in entertainment areas. Many venues accept card payments, but carrying some cash is advisable for smaller vendors.
